SFS Drone Detection System
This requirement is for a Brand Name Drone Detection Shield, providing a counter-small Unmanned Aircraft System (C-sUAS) capability for persistent detection, identification, classification, and alerting of sUAS. The system will protect training operations at Columbus Air Force Base (CAFB), MS, support base security, and provide centralized situational awareness to the Base Defense Operations Center. The solution must allow for a future defeat capability to be added without replacing core detection infrastructure. The acquisition includes one Lot of the Drone Shield Immediate Response Kit, with all associated non-personal services, labor, tools, and equipment for setup and implementation.
